Our preventative maintenance service takes a proactive approach, meticulously inspecting every part of your gate system to identify and resolve potential issues before they become costly problems. This includes thorough examinations of the gate's physical structure, the operator's mechanical integrity, and the intricate electronic controls, all crucial for the diverse conditions in Rancho Cucamonga.
During a Viking gate service, our expert technicians carefully lubricate all moving parts, adjust chain tension (for slide gates), check for wear on hinges and rollers, and tighten any loose fasteners. We also conduct comprehensive diagnostics on the VGB-2 control board, testing safety photo eyes, limit switches, and the battery backup system to ensure all safety features are fully operational and comply with local regulations and industry standards. This holistic approach helps prevent unexpected breakdowns and ensures continuous security for your property.

Our Viking gate service protocols are informed by extensive knowledge of Viking Access Systems' engineering, ensuring specialized care for your specific model. We perform targeted checks relevant to models like the K-2, G-5, and R-6, crucial for their optimal function in Rancho Cucamonga's varied climate. This includes verifying the proper torque settings for powerful hydraulic or electromechanical motors, inspecting the integrity of all wiring for signs of corrosion or rodent damage often seen in local environments, and calibrating the sensitivity of obstruction sensors for maximum safety.
We pay particular attention to the battery backup system, a critical component for Viking gates during the occasional power outages or brownouts that can occur across the Inland Empire. Our service includes testing the battery's charge level, inspecting its terminals for corrosion from temperature fluctuations, and ensuring the charging circuit is functioning correctly. Faulty battery systems are a common oversight that can leave your property vulnerable. We also perform a comprehensive review of the gate's overall balance and alignment, which directly impacts the longevity and efficiency of the operator.
Furthermore, our technicians update firmware where applicable and check for any recalls or service bulletins issued by Viking Access Systems that might affect your specific model. This level of detail ensures that your Viking gate not only functions but does so with optimal efficiency, safety, and compliance with local standards. Without regular service, the internal gears, bearings, or gate rollers of your Viking system can slowly degrade under the constant use common in Rancho Cucamonga. This silent wear leads to increased friction and strain, often resulting in sudden, expensive failures if not caught and addressed during routine maintenance.
Rancho Cucamonga's climate, with its dry conditions and Santa Ana winds, means dust, dirt, and leaves frequently build up in operator housings, around safety sensors, or within track systems. This accumulation impedes smooth gate movement, interferes with safety features, and can cause motors to overheat – all preventable with regular cleaning and inspection.
Exposure to Rancho Cucamonga's temperature extremes and gate vibration can cause electrical connections to loosen or corrode over time, leading to intermittent power delivery or sensor malfunctions. Regular service includes checking, cleaning, and securing these connections to maintain consistent electronic performance and prevent unexpected shutdowns.
Safety photo eyes and auto-reverse mechanisms, critical for preventing accidents, can gradually lose calibration or become misaligned due to minor impacts or ground shifting, which can be exacerbated by local seismic activity. Routine service ensures these crucial safety features are precisely adjusted and fully functional, keeping your family and property safe.
The backup battery, essential for keeping your gate operational during power outages (especially in areas prone to grid strain like the Inland Empire), has a finite lifespan. Without regular testing and replacement, it can fail unnoticed, leaving your gate inoperable during critical moments. Service checks ensure its readiness and optimal charge.
